Bale joined Madrid for Ronaldo

Former Real Madrid star Gareth Bale says he joined Los Blancos because of Cristiano Ronaldo. Bale also admitted that he never had any kind of conflict with anyone during his Madrid career.

The Ronaldo-Bale duo have won four Champions League titles for Madrid. Through this, Madrid made a special place for themselves in Europe’s highest club competition.

In a recent interview, Bale said it was difficult to be around Ronaldo after the match. Especially if he could not score in that match, even if the team won, Ronaldo could not keep his mood. The Welshman, however, dismissed any dispute with Ronaldo. Although Bale has now retired from all forms of football, Ronaldo plays for Al Nasre in the Saudi professional league.

In an interview given to The Times, Bale said, ‘I have never had a problem with Ronaldo or anyone else at Real Madrid for a single day. I don’t think I ever disagreed with anyone on anything. Even when the team was having a tough time, we had a good time in the dressing room. I really enjoyed the rest of my time in Madrid, apart from a bit of a tough time on the pitch. I have no regrets. I have taken the right decision at the right time.’

Bale also said, ‘The biggest reason behind joining Madrid was Cristiano and Benzema. Along with them, it was a privilege to play in the same club with players like Modric, Alonso and later Toni Kroos. I never wanted to be Galactico, just play and then disappear into the darkness.’

Bale, 33, has given up football to focus on his lifelong love of golf. Bell recently played in the BMW PGA Championship Celebrity Pro-Am line-up. It was the first step in his debut as a professional golfer.
